<TABLE>	<C>					<C>
FORM 13F INFORMATION TABLE			VALUE	SHARES/	SH/	PUT/	INVSTMT	OTHER	VOTING AUTHORITY
NAME OF ISSUER	TITLE OF CLASS	CUSIP	(x$1000)	PRN AMT	PRN	CALL	DSCRETN	MANAGERS	SOLE	SHARED	NONE
APPLE INC.	COM	037833100	19682	99360	SH		SOLE		47060	0	52300
ADVANCED ANALOGIC TECHNOL	COM	00752J108	17	1436	SH		SOLE		1436	0	0
AECOM TECHNOLOGY CORP.	COM	00766T100	14	470	SH		SOLE		470	0	0
AMAG PHARMACEUTICALS INC.	COM	00753P103	15	240	SH		SOLE		240	0	0
AMERICAN APPAREL INC.	COM	023850100	1	94	SH		SOLE		94	0	0
ARENA RESOURCES INC.	COM	040049108	24	584	SH		SOLE		584	0	0
AMERIGON INC.	COM	03070L300	1	66	SH		SOLE		66	0	0
ASCENT SOLAR TECHNOLOGIES	COM	043635101	2	72	SH		SOLE		72	0	0
AMTECH SYSTEMS INC.	COM	032332504	2	124	SH		SOLE		124	0	0
ALPHATEC HOLDINGS INC.	COM	02081G102	1	272	SH		SOLE		272	0	0
ATHEROS COMMUNICATIONS IN	COM	04743P108	15	492	SH		SOLE		492	0	0
ASTRONICS CORP.	COM	046433108	1	20	SH		SOLE		20	0	0
ATWOOD OCEANICS INC.	COM	050095108	33	334	SH		SOLE		334	0	0
AUTHENTEC INC.	COM	052660107	1	94	SH		SOLE		94	0	0
ALLEGHENY ENERGY INC.	COM	017361106	13512	212430	SH		SOLE		97230	0	115200
BIOSCRIP INC.	COM	09069N108	1	186	SH		SOLE		186	0	0
MICHAEL BAKER CORP.	COM	057149106	1	34	SH		SOLE		34	0	0
BIOMARIN PHARMACEUTICAL I	COM	09061G101	17	460	SH		SOLE		460	0	0
BIOMIMETIC THERAPEUTICS I	COM	09064X101	1	62	SH		SOLE		62	0	0
BLUEPHOENIX SOLUTIONS LTD	COM	M20157109	20	1086	SH		SOLE		1086	0	0
BIO-REFERENCE LABORATORIE	COM	09057G602	23	704	SH		SOLE		704	0	0
BALLY TECHNOLOGIES INC.	COM	05874B107	26	532	SH		SOLE		532	0	0
CAM COMMERCE SOLUTIONS IN	COM	131916108	13	316	SH		SOLE		316	0	0
CAMERON INTERNATIONAL COR	COM	13342B105	10923	226948	SH		SOLE		104948	0	122000
CAVIUM NETWORKS INC.	COM	14965A101	11	480	SH		SOLE		480	0	0
CHINA DIRECT INC.	COM	169384104	1	162	SH		SOLE		162	0	0
CENTRAL EUROPEAN DISTRIBU	COM	153435102	23	396	SH		SOLE		396	0	0
CF INDUSTRIES HOLDINGS IN	COM	125269100	26	240	SH		SOLE		240	0	0
CHINA FIRE & SECURITY GRO	COM	16938R103	11	900	SH		SOLE		900	0	0
CORE LABORATORIES N.V.	COM	N22717107	26	208	SH		SOLE		208	0	0
CUMMINS INC.	COM	231021106	9134	71710	SH		SOLE		33210	0	38500
COMTECH GROUP INC.	COM	205821200	1	90	SH		SOLE		90	0	0
COMVERGE INC.	COM	205859101	12	366	SH		SOLE		366	0	0
CEPHEID	COM	15670R107	18	690	SH		SOLE		690	0	0
CAPELLA EDUCATION CO.	COM	139594105	13	188	SH		SOLE		188	0	0
CERAGON NETWORKS LTD.	ORD	M22013102	1	92	SH		SOLE		92	0	0
CROCS INC.	COM	227046109	9	250	SH		SOLE		250	0	0
CISCO SYSTEMS INC.	COM	17275R102	13309	491670	SH		SOLE		228670	0	263000
CHINA SECURITY & SURVEILL	COM	16942J105	15	680	SH		SOLE		680	0	0
COMMVAULT SYSTEMS INC.	COM	204166102	17	804	SH		SOLE		804	0	0
CONSOLIDATED WATER CO. IN	ORD	G23773107	1	40	SH		SOLE		40	0	0
CYNOSURE INC. (CL A)	CL A	232577205	9	366	SH		SOLE		366	0	0
DARLING INTERNATIONAL INC	COM	237266101	23	1944	SH		SOLE		1944	0	0
DEERE & CO.	COM	244199105	10007	107470	SH		SOLE		49970	0	57500
DECKERS OUTDOOR CORP.	COM	243537107	13	84	SH		SOLE		84	0	0
DG FASTCHANNEL INC.	COM	23326R109	15	554	SH		SOLE		554	0	0
DIGITAL REALTY TRUST INC.	COM	25386810	18	470	SH		SOLE		470	0	0
GENENTECH INC.	COM	368710406	8149	121490	SH		SOLE		55890	0	65600
DAWSON GEOPHYSICAL CO.	COM	239359102	14	188	SH		SOLE		188	0	0
ELIXIR GAMING TECHNOLOGIE	COM	28661G105	2	404	SH		SOLE		404	0	0
ECHELON CORP.	COM	27874N105	13	654	SH		SOLE		654	0	0
EMCORE CORP.	COM	290846104	2	138	SH		SOLE		138	0	0
ENERGYSOUTH INC.	COM	292970100	18	314	SH		SOLE		314	0	0
EQUINIX INC.	COM	29444U502	19	188	SH		SOLE		188	0	0
EUROSEAS LTD.	COM	Y23592200	1	120	SH		SOLE		120	0	0
EXPRESS SCRIPTS INC.	COM	302182100	12203	167160	SH		SOLE		77560	0	89600
ENTERGY CORP.	COM	29364G103	11133	93150	SH		SOLE		42950	0	50200
FALCONSTOR SOFTWARE INC.	COM	306137100	10	930	SH		SOLE		930	0	0
FCSTONE GROUP INC.	COM	31308T100	18	398	SH		SOLE		398	0	0
FOCUS MEDIA HOLDING LTD. 	ADR	34415V109	10105	177880	SH		SOLE		82180	0	95700
FURMANITE CORP.	COM	361086101	18	1458	SH		SOLE		1458	0	0
FUSHI INTERNATIONAL INC.	COM	36113C101	16	630	SH		SOLE		630	0	0
L.B. FOSTER CO.	COM	350060109	16	292	SH		SOLE		292	0	0
FUEL TECH INC.	COM	359523107	1	40	SH		SOLE		40	0	0
FLOTEK INDUSTRIES INC.	COM	343389102	14	376	SH		SOLE		376	0	0
GEOEYE INC.	COM	37250W108	27	804	SH		SOLE		804	0	0
GENOMIC HEALTH INC.	COM	37244C101	2	70	SH		SOLE		70	0	0
GIGAMEDIA LTD.	ORD	Y2711Y104	11	596	SH		SOLE		596	0	0
GILDAN ACTIVEWEAR INC.	COM	375916103	19	460	SH		SOLE		460	0	0
GAMESTOP CORP. CL A	CL A	36467W109	11845	190700	SH		SOLE		88800	0	101900
GLOBAL TRAFFIC NETWORK IN	COM	37947B103	1	220	SH		SOLE		220	0	0
GENCO SHIPPING & TRADING 	COM	Y2685T107	15	262	SH		SOLE		262	0	0
GOOGLE INC. (CL A)	CL A	38259P508	21458	31030	SH		SOLE		14850	0	16180
GLOBAL SOURCES LTD.	ORD	G39300101	27	957	SH		SOLE		957	0	0
GSE SYSTEMS INC.	COM	36227K106	2	160	SH		SOLE		160	0	0
HILL INTERNATIONAL INC.	COM	431466101	2	112	SH		SOLE		112	0	0
HANSEN MEDICAL INC.	COM	411307101	16	514	SH		SOLE		514	0	0
HOKU SCIENTIFIC INC.	COM	434712105	1	100	SH		SOLE		100	0	0
HARBIN ELECTRIC INC.	COM	41145W109	1	50	SH		SOLE		50	0	0
HURON CONSULTING GROUP IN	COM	447462102	21	262	SH		SOLE		262	0	0
ICON PLC (ADS)	ADR	45103T107	18	292	SH		SOLE		292	0	0
INTERACTIVE INTELLIGENCE 	COM	45839M103	13	480	SH		SOLE		480	0	0
I-SECTOR CORP.	COM	46185W109	1	138	SH		SOLE		138	0	0
IRIS INTERNATIONAL INC.	COM	46270W105	1	74	SH		SOLE		74	0	0
ISIS PHARMACEUTICALS INC.	COM	464330109	13	794	SH		SOLE		794	0	0
JOHNSON CONTROLS INC.	COM	478366107	11385	315890	SH		SOLE		146990	0	168900
KEY TECHNOLOGY INC.	COM	493143101	1	36	SH		SOLE		36	0	0
K-TRON INTERNATIONAL INC.	COM	482730108	1	12	SH		SOLE		12	0	0
LMI AEROSPACE INC.	COM	502079106	15	536	SH		SOLE		536	0	0
LSB INDUSTRIES INC.	COM	502160104	1	48	SH		SOLE		48	0	0
MASTERCARD INC. (CL A)	CL A	57636Q104	7632	35460	SH		SOLE		16560	0	18900
METALICO INC.	COM	591176102	1	118	SH		SOLE		118	0	0
MGM MIRAGE	COM	552953101	12674	150840	SH		SOLE		70140	0	80700
MIDDLEBY CORP.	COM	596278101	14	178	SH		SOLE		178	0	0
MONSANTO CO.	COM	61166W101	22665	202930	SH		SOLE		97630	0	105300
MTS MEDICATION TECHNOLOGI	COM	553773102	2	130	SH		SOLE		130	0	0
MINDRAY MEDICAL INTERNATI	ADR	602675100	13	292	SH		SOLE		292	0	0
MICROSOFT CORP.	COM	594918104	13796	387510	SH		SOLE		179810	0	207700
MATRIX SERVICE CO.	COM	576853105	1	48	SH		SOLE		48	0	0
MANITOWOC CO.	COM	563571108	16688	341740	SH		SOLE		158940	0	182800
NETSUITE INC.	COM	64118Q107	20	512	SH		SOLE		512	0	0
NII HOLDINGS INC.	COM	62913F201	7975	165060	SH		SOLE		76360	0	88700
NAVIOS MARITIME HOLDINGS 	COM	Y62196103	13	1028	SH		SOLE		1028	0	0
NOKIA CORP. (ADR)	ADR	654902204	9386	244480	SH		SOLE		112080	0	132400
NANOSPHERE INC.	COM	63009F105	1	104	SH		SOLE		104	0	0
NTELOS HOLDINGS CORP.	COM	67020Q107	21	700	SH		SOLE		700	0	0
NUANCE COMMUNICATIONS INC	COM	67020Y100	10829	579690	SH		SOLE		265190	0	314500
NETWORK EQUIPMENT TECHNOL	COM	641208103	8	1002	SH		SOLE		1002	0	0
OCEANEERING INTERNATIONAL	COM	675232102	13	188	SH		SOLE		188	0	0
OBAGI MEDICAL PRODUCTS IN	COM	67423R108	1	68	SH		SOLE		68	0	0
OMRIX BIOPHARMACEUTICALS 	COM	681989109	1	36	SH		SOLE		36	0	0
ORBITAL SCIENCES CORP.	COM	685564106	16	648	SH		SOLE		648	0	0
PRICELINE.COM INC.	COM	741503403	24	210	SH		SOLE		210	0	0
PRECISION CASTPARTS CORP.	COM	740189105	12544	90444	SH		SOLE		41644	0	48800
PROCTER & GAMBLE CO.	COM	742718109	13736	187090	SH		SOLE		86690	0	100400
PEERLESS MANUFACTURING CO	COM	705514107	1	30	SH		SOLE		30	0	0
POSSIS MEDICAL INC.	COM	737407106	1	102	SH		SOLE		102	0	0
PERFICIENT INC.	COM	71375U101	1	68	SH		SOLE		68	0	0
PROS HOLDINGS INC.	COM	74346Y103	14	670	SH		SOLE		670	0	0
PHOENIX TECHNOLOGIES LTD.	COM	719153108	14	1116	SH		SOLE		1116	0	0
QUALCOMM INC.	COM	747525103	11172	283940	SH		SOLE		131840	0	152100
RADNET INC.	COM	750491102	2	154	SH		SOLE		154	0	0
REPLIGEN CORP.	COM	759916109	2	256	SH		SOLE		256	0	0
RICK'S CABARET INTERNATIO	COM	765641303	2	68	SH		SOLE		68	0	0
TRANSOCEAN INC.	COM	G90073100	15312	106970	SH		SOLE		49770	0	57200
COMPANHIA VALE DO RIO DOC	ADR	204412209	7620	233260	SH		SOLE		108560	0	124700
RBC BEARINGS INC.	COM	75524B104	13	292	SH		SOLE		292	0	0
SAPIENT CORP.	COM	803062108	14	1484	SH		SOLE		1484	0	0
CHARLES SCHWAB CORP.	COM	808513105	13972	546850	SH		SOLE		253850	0	293000
COMSCORE INC.	COM	20564W105	12	366	SH		SOLE		366	0	0
SHENGDATECH INC.	COM	823213103	2	136	SH		SOLE		136	0	0
SENORX INC.	COM	81724W104	1	118	SH		SOLE		118	0	0
SCHERING-PLOUGH CORP.	COM	806605101	11678	438390	SH		SOLE		203890	0	234500
SALARY.COM INC.	COM	794006106	1	112	SH		SOLE		112	0	0
SPIRIT AEROSYSTEMS HOLDIN	CL A	848574109	10	314	SH		SOLE		314	0	0
SUNPOWER CORP. (CL A)	CL A	867652109	18	136	SH		SOLE		136	0	0
STERICYCLE INC.	COM	858912108	28	480	SH		SOLE		480	0	0
3SBIO INC. (ADS)	ADR	88575Y105	2	102	SH		SOLE		102	0	0
STRYKER CORP.	COM	863667101	15574	208430	SH		SOLE		96830	0	111600
SYNOVIS LIFE TECHNOLOGIES	COM	87162G105	1	70	SH		SOLE		70	0	0
TRANSDIGM GROUP INC.	COM	893641100	20	450	SH		SOLE		450	0	0
TEAM INC.	COM	878155100	15	386	SH		SOLE		386	0	0
TALEO CORP. (CL A)	CL A	87424N104	16	522	SH		SOLE		522	0	0
TERRA INDUSTRIES INC.	COM	880915103	29	618	SH		SOLE		618	0	0
T-3 ENERGY SERVICES INC.	COM	87306E107	13	286	SH		SOLE		286	0	0
TUTOGEN MEDICAL INC.	COM	901107102	14	1264	SH		SOLE		1264	0	0
THIRD WAVE TECHNOLOGIES I	COM	88428W108	14	1432	SH		SOLE		1432	0	0
UNIVERSAL ELECTRONICS INC	COM	913483103	24	732	SH		SOLE		732	0	0
U.S. GEOTHERMAL INC.	COM	90338S102	1	352	SH		SOLE		352	0	0
ULTRALIFE BATTERIES INC.	COM	903899102	25	1198	SH		SOLE		1198	0	0
VCG HOLDING CORP.	COM	91821K101	3	192	SH		SOLE		192	0	0
VNUS MEDICAL TECHNOLOGIES	COM	928566108	2	104	SH		SOLE		104	0	0
VOCUS INC.	COM	92858J108	2	44	SH		SOLE		44	0	0
WONDER AUTO TECHNOLOGY IN	COM	978166106	2	136	SH		SOLE		136	0	0
YUCHENG TECHNOLOGIES LTD.	COM	G98777108	1	80	SH		SOLE		80	0	0
ZOLTEK COS.	COM	98975W104	22	522	SH		SOLE		522	0	0
</TABLE>